loadbalancer-aware targets.
Using this will enable dynamic url discovery via ribbon including incrementing server request
counts. MyService api = Feign.builder().target(LoadBalancingTarget.create(MyService.class, "http://myAppProd"))Where
myAppProd is the ribbon loadbalancer name and myAppProd.ribbon.listOfServers configuration is set.| Modifier | Constructor and Description |
